Larkhall train station offers a variety of amenities for travelers. While there is no ticket office, you can easily collect pre-purchased tickets from the available ticket machines. It’s easily accessible with step-free pathways throughout, making it a Category A station, and complete with services such as CCTV and help points to ensure safety and assistance if needed. Despite the absence of refreshment facilities, public Wi-Fi, or even an ATM, the station makes up for it with its functional simplicity and ease of navigation, especially for those with accessibility needs. Blue Badge parking is available, with 13 designated spaces to cater to users requiring easy access.
Larkhall station is integrally linked with various modes of transport. For those moments when the trains are interrupted, a rail replacement bus service can be boarded on Caledonian Road, right across from the Police Station. The station also features easy access to taxis, with details available via TrainTaxi services. For bus enthusiasts, there’s comprehensive information on routes and services available on Traveline Scotland, ensuring your journey is smooth from start to finish.

Moorthorpe station, operated by Northern, may not boast the vast array of amenities like larger stations, but it manages to cater effectively to the needs of its passengers. Though it lacks a traditional ticket office, ticket machines are readily available, ensuring effortless ticket collection for journeys purchased online. It's a station that's about straightforward, accessible travel—no frills needed.
Accessibility is partially provided, with step-free access available on parts of the station. Travelers heading to York can enjoy level access to their platform, while those destined for Sheffield can utilize the ramped access. Despite being unstaffed, there's always an option to call the helpline for assistance, making travel as stress-free as possible.
While you won't find waiting rooms, refreshments, or shopping facilities here, Moorthorpe does prioritize safety and basic conveniences with features like basic CCTV coverage and an induction loop for hearing assistance. Bicycle storage is available, offering 10 sheltered spaces on Platform 2, making it a sensible choice for eco-conscious travelers looking to reduce their carbon footprint.
Moorthorpe provides easy access to several transport services making onward travel seamless. While the station doesn't play host to a bustling taxi rank on site, visitors can utilize the Cab4You service for reliable taxi connections. Bus services are close by, ensuring that passengers can connect to local amenities and neighboring towns without hassle. For those requiring rail replacement services, the pickup and drop-off points are conveniently located on the main road, Barnsley Rd.
